To determine the kilocalories in a gram, we need to consider the macronutrient breakdown of the food. Each macronutrient—carbohydrates, proteins, and fats—contributes differently to the total calorie content. Practically speaking, Carbohydrates typically provide about 4 kilocalories per gram, while proteins offer around 4 kilocalories as well, and fats are the most energy-dense, delivering approximately 9 kilocalories per gram. These values are approximate and can vary slightly depending on the source and processing of the food Easy to understand, harder to ignore..
